We found that the core of this experience is a 60-minute, hands-on massage that employs pressure using thumbs, fingers, palms, and elbows. Developed in Japan, Shiatsu is all about precise, firm touch aimed at stimulating acupuncture points—those tiny spots believed to influence energy flow and bodily functions.
The massage begins with a brief consultation, often carried out by a skilled therapist, who determines areas of tension or discomfort. From there, the therapist uses rhythmic pressing, kneading, and stretching techniques to release tight muscles. You might notice the therapist focusing on your shoulders, neck, and back—common trouble zones for most travelers—though the focus can be tailored to your needs.

The tour starts at 229 Nguyễn Vĩnh Thới, Phước Mỹ, Sơn Trà, Đà Nẵng, a conveniently located point in Da Nang. With a location near public transportation, most travelers will find it easy to reach, whether you’re coming from your hotel, the city center, or other attractions. The experience concludes back at the same meeting point, providing a straightforward start and finish.
Operating hours are generous—from 10 AM to 10 PM daily—giving flexibility for fitting this into your itinerary. Whether you prefer a morning session to kickstart your day or an evening wind-down, this schedule suits most travelers.

Is this a private or group experience?
This is a private tour/activity, meaning only your group will participate, which allows for personalized attention and a more relaxing atmosphere.
How long does the massage last?
The session lasts approximately 1 hour, giving enough time for thorough work on tension areas without feeling rushed.
What is the cost of this massage?
The price is $23.70 per person, offering good value considering the professional service and therapy quality.
Are there any specific times I should book?
The spa operates daily from 10 AM to 10 PM, so you can choose a time that fits your schedule—ideal for early mornings or late evenings.
Is booking confirmation immediate?
Yes, confirmation is received at the time of booking, making planning simple and hassle-free.
Can I cancel if my plans change?
Yes, free cancellation is available up to 24 hours in advance. Cancellations made less than 24 hours before will not be refunded.
